Last year, I started looking for a way to communicate with my 3 teenagers while they were in their rooms with the doors closed, without yelling at the top of my lungs to be heard over their airpods. Texting would have probably worked but felt wrong. Dedicated wireless intercom systems are clunky, unreliable, and expensive.

Giving the kids each an Echo, either the Dot or the Flex, and putting one in the kitchen as well gave me an easy way to solve this problem. I can use the Echo as an intercom to drop in on one or all of the kids when I need to. This has been a lifesaver for us! I also use the kitchen Echo to play music, which works quite well of course.

I'm not a fan of the privacy implications of having Echo devices in my house. Amazon does provide some controls for that, at least.

Web pages use SVG to render vector graphics. It uses the exact same imaging model as PDF and is implemented in all modern browsers. The web in general has taken a lot of lessons from Adobe because Warnock and Geshke, in the PostScript Red Book, got so much right about how to build an image model that many GUI developers are still learning today. If you start with a PDF, it should be possible to machine-translate it to SVG and present it as a web page.
